Percussion
The University of North Texas Percussion area is a diverse and innovative program that has set high standards in percussion education and performance for decades. In addition to outstanding classical percussion offerings, the program boasts one of the finest jazz drum set programs in the country.
Combining a unique balance of traditional classical percussion combined with an extensive world music curricula, students learn by performing the music of Brazil, Cuba, Trinidad, India, Indonesia and West Africa.
